12 weeks: June 1st - August 21st or June 22nd - September 11th
As a Software Engineering Intern within our Kernels team, you will play a key role in developing high performance kernels essential for accelerating Machine Learning models. Your responsibilities will span developing reference implementations for accuracy verification, defining unit tests for implemented operators, performance tuning, scalability analysis across varied problem sizes, and packaging/shipping the final implementations. You will also collect performance metrics and identify bottlenecks to improve core functionality.
